So, it's been a while since the Pens and the Red Wings played a meaningful game. Due to the lockout and the abbreviated 2012-13 season schedule being limited to intra-conference games only, the last time the Pens played the Wings in a game that counts was two years ago yesterday. The Wings came to Consol and left with a 4-1 win. Today, the Pens return the visit and let's hope they are the same gracious visitors the Wings were two years ago.

In other news around the NHL, Steven Stamkos is back on skates one month after breaking his tibia in what was feared to be the end of his Olympic dream. Now, he still has TWO MONTHS left before Canada plays their first game. All hail the Stammer.

The Oilers have traded goaltender Jason LaBarbera to the Chicago Blackhawks in exchange for future considerations, and activated Ilya Bryzgalov from the injured reserve.

I bet the Maple Leafs are feeling that the David Clarkson signing was such great value for the money. He now has 2 goals and 2 suspensions on the season, keeping him on pace for 6 goals, 18 points and 28 games lost to suspensions.
